Iroquois: The Girl Who Was Not Satisfied With Simple Things

     
   Can you discriminate good apples from bad ones by their appearances?  For me, it is difficult.  Appearances can often be deceptive.  Sometimes, judging by appearance can be misleading.  The girl in the story "The Girl Who Was Not Satisfied With Simple Things" is a sample for us.  She is always very critical to the appearances of the men who want to take her as wife.  Later on, she married a handsome warrior, who turns out to be a horned serpent.  So, don't always go by appearances.  
    However, the girl is the lucky one.  She is able to get rid of the serpent.  Then, she learns how to be satisfied with simple things.
